In 2019-2020, 169,876 biological and biomedical sciences students received their degree, making the major the 9th most popular in the country. In 2017-2018, biological and biomedical sciences gra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$30,082 and had an average of $24,534 in loans still to pay off.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Middlebury College. The school came in at #1 for the Best Value Biological & Biomedical Sciences Schools for a Bachelor’s in Vermont For Those Making $75-$110k. Middlebury is a small private not-for-profit school situated in Middlebury, Vermont. It awarded 101 bachelors’s biological and biomedical sciences degrees in 2019-2020.
Middlebury also made our “Best Biological & Biomedical Sciences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Vermont” list, coming in at #1. The yearly cost to attend Middlebury College is $20,468 for Vermont Bachelor’s Degree Biological & Biomedical Sciences students whose families make $75-$110k.
The student loan default rate at the school is 1.0%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%. Students who start out at the school are likely to stick around. The freshman retention rate is 89%. With a student-to-faculty ratio of 8 to 1, it’s easy to see that the school is committed to helping their undergraduates succeed.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of Vermont. It ranked #2 on our 2022 Best Value Biological & Biomedical Sciences Schools for a Bachelor’s in Vermont For Those Making $75-$110k list. Burlington, Vermont is the setting for this fairly large institution of higher learning. The public school handed out bachelors’s biological and biomedical sciences degrees to 253 students in 2019-2020.
UVM also made our “Best Biological & Biomedical Sciences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Vermont” list, coming in at #3. The yearly cost to attend University of Vermont is $21,595 for Vermont Bachelor’s Degree Biological & Biomedical Sciences students whose families make $75-$110k.
With a freshman retention rate of 85%, the school does an excellent job of retaining its students. The student loan default rate at the school is 2.4%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Saint Michael’s College. It ranked #3 on our 2022 Best Value Biological & Biomedical Sciences Schools for a Bachelor’s in Vermont For Those Making $75-$110k list. Saint Michael’s is a small school located in Colchester, Vermont that handed out 62 bachelors’s biological and biomedical sciences degrees in 2019-2020.
As a testament to the quality of education offered at Saint Michael’s, the school also landed the #2 spot in our “Best Biological & Biomedical Sciences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Vermont” ranking. It costs about $27,324 for vermont bachelor’s degree biological & biomedical sciences students whose families make $75-$110k per year to attend Saint Michael’s College.
With a freshman retention rate of 86%, the school does an excellent job of retaining its students. The low student loan default rate of 2.3%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.
